Summary
The From the Top Fellowship empowers young musicians, ages 8-18, by providing them with resources to explore their musical careers. Participants engage in a dynamic community, access professional mentorship, and celebrate their talent on a national platform. The program culminates in collaborative projects and performances, connecting fellows with a network of over 3,000 alumni. This fellowship not only nurtures musical skills but also emphasizes community engagement and personal growth, making it essential for aspiring artists.Overview
In today’s world, being a musician is so much more than just performing. Learning and Media Lab Fellows join a dynamic community that care about: exploring ways to make an impact through music now and in the futureaccessing professional tools and mentorslearning about the multiple career avenues for a musician todaycelebrating their music and voices on a major national platform At the end of the remote learning program, Fellows: work together to plan and implement a community engagement activity.record their solo or ensemble performance and interview for From the Top’s national radio program and podcast.collaborate on From the Top’s digital mediajoin a network of more than 3,000 alumni including students, professional musicians, educators, and arts administrators.Eligibility

Are a musician between the ages of 8–18 and have not enrolled in a college or conservatory.High School Seniors must apply by November 15th of their senior year.Live in or have a significant training connection to the US.Focus Areas & Funding Uses
